Upload Files by Default When Inserting Media
by cubecolour · Media
Also makes 15 other plugins · 20.5K+ installs across the portfolio →
Makes the Upload Files tab active rather than the Media Library Tab when adding images or other media to a page or post. Useful if you do not often re …
